Répondre à la discussion
Affichage des résultats 1 à 9 sur 9

CP2102 + Arduino Pro Mini 5V/16Mhz ATmega328 == avrdude: stk500_getsync(): not in sync: resp=0x



  1. #1
    sori2

    Thumbs down CP2102 + Arduino Pro Mini 5V/16Mhz ATmega328 == avrdude: stk500_getsync(): not in sync: resp=0x


    ------

    Bonjour,

    Je me retrouve dans la même situation que : http://forums.futura-sciences.com/el...resp-0x00.html :
    • un arduino pro mini dont la led verte clignote toute les secondes (Atmega328 Pro Mini Atmega328p Module pour Arduino Esp8266 3,3 V 8mhz)
    • dans lequel je tente de téléverser en vain (à l'aide d'un Convertisseur USB to TTL Converter Module with Built-in CP2102 Un Set)


    Sauf que je suis visiblement parvenu à téléverser une fois: je n'ai pas eu de message d'erreur et la led verte ne clignote plus.
    • J'ai veillé à croiser RX et TX
    • J'ai tenté de télécharger un driver spécifique pour l'ESP8266
    • j'ai essayé de resetter avant de téléverser
    • j'ai désinstaller et réinstallé le driver du TTL
    • j'ai essayé de passer en 5V et aussi d'alimenter l'arduino directement (pas du convertisseur)
    • j'ai vérifié les soudures


    Auriez-vous une idée?

    Cdlt,

    Pierre

    -----
    Dernière modification par Antoane ; 21/04/2017 à 22h05. Motif: Déterrage > création d'une nouvelle discussion

  2. Publicité
  3. #2
    vincent66

    Re : CP2102 + Arduino Pro Mini 5V/16Mhz ATmega328 == avrdude: stk500_getsync(): not in sync: resp=0x

    Bonsoir,
    Voui une bonne idée..: bazarde cet arduicon à la déchetterie...!
    Leonardo était ingénieur "sans papier", et moi diplômé juste...technicien...

  4. #3
    Antoane

    Re : CP2102 + Arduino Pro Mini 5V/16Mhz ATmega328 == avrdude: stk500_getsync(): not in sync: resp=0x

    Bonsoir,

    @vincent66 : tu fais régulièrement la promotion des picaxes tout en ne ratant pas une occasion de descendre l'arduino (et toujours de manière constructive ). C'est pourtant, me semble-t-il, le même genre de carte/composant pour bricoleur (pour prototypage rapide, pour personne n'ayant pas pour but de maitriser et comprendre son µC). C'est pourquoi j'ai du mal à comprendre ta position...
    Bonsoir.
    Deux pattes c'est une diode, trois pattes c'est un transistor, quatre pattes c'est une vache.

  5. #4
    freepicbasic

    Re : CP2102 + Arduino Pro Mini 5V/16Mhz ATmega328 == avrdude: stk500_getsync(): not in sync: resp=0x

    J'ai eu un module défectueux qui faisait ça.

    J'ai essayé de savoir ce qu'il avait , puisque ça clignotait le µc semblait donc fonctionner.
    J'ai connecté l'interface Jtag pour le programmer en direct, ç a fonctionné.

    Et je me suis rendu compte que le port série n'envoyait pas les données à la bonne vitesse.

    J'ai vérifier l'horloge elle était bien à 16Mhz.
    Mais parfois le fait de mettre la sonde peut ajouter une capacité parasite et corriger le problème le temps de la mesure.
    ça aurait pu être les condos, car j'ai eu ce problème sur des pics.

    Bon, si on se servait pas du port série et programmait en JTAG on pouvait faire un appli qui nécessitait pas trop de sécurité...

    Peut être aussi les bits de config...
    Vu le prix du module , je me suis arrêté là,
    J'en ai déduit que le µc était défectueux, mais si quelqu'un avait une autre explication ça serait intéressant de savoir exactement.

    Car lors d'une fabrication en quantité , certain module peuvent mal fonctionner, car un composant ou autre est limite, ce qui fait que un pourcentage ne fonctionne pas , c'était le cas de mes pics en mettant 22pf au lieu de 15pf , tous les modules fonctionnaient.
    ça peut engendrer des problèmes aléatoires , difficiles à trouver.
    A+, pat

  6. #5
    sori2

    Re : CP2102 + Arduino Pro Mini 5V/16Mhz ATmega328 == avrdude: stk500_getsync(): not in sync: resp=0x

    Bonjour,

    Apparemment c'est du au fait que je ne résette pas bien. Ça me fait penser au démarrage en mode sans échec de windows...
    Bref, j'ai réussi à téléverser un second croquis après 5 essais et cette fois j'ai pu vérifier qu'il était bien chargé.

    Pas bien pratique d'autant plus qu'il fallait trouver le bon gestionnaire de carte, s'assurer que le pilote du TTL était le bon,

    Amicalement,

  7. A voir en vidéo sur Futura
  8. #6
    freepicbasic

    Re : CP2102 + Arduino Pro Mini 5V/16Mhz ATmega328 == avrdude: stk500_getsync(): not in sync: resp=0x

    Il existe 2 types de convertisseur USB/TTL RS232, avec 5 ou 6 fils.
    Le 6iem fil c est le DTR qui permet de reseter l'Atmel avec un condo de 0.1µf relié au reset.
    Si on a une carte 5 fils sans DTR il faudra appuyer sur le reset manuellement, et parfois il faut si reprendre à plusieurs reprises pour que ça fonctionne.


    Attention certains ont 6 fils, mais ils ont un fil 3.3V au lieu de DTR et donc pas de DTR, donc bien regarder !
    A+, pat

  9. Publicité
  10. #7
    freepicbasic

    Re : CP2102 + Arduino Pro Mini 5V/16Mhz ATmega328 == avrdude: stk500_getsync(): not in sync: resp=0x

    Celui ci par exemple a 6 fils avec un DTR et un 3V au lieu du CTS qui ne nous sert pas en Arduino.
    Images attachées Images attachées
    A+, pat

  11. #8
    Yvan_Delaserge

    Re : CP2102 + Arduino Pro Mini 5V/16Mhz ATmega328 == avrdude: stk500_getsync(): not in sync: resp=0x

    Citation Envoyé par Antoane Voir le message
    Bonsoir,

    @vincent66 : tu fais régulièrement la promotion des picaxes tout en ne ratant pas une occasion de descendre l'arduino (et touiujours de manière constructive ). C'est pourtant, me semble-t-il, le même genre de carte/composant pour bricoleur (pour prototypage rapide, pour personne n'ayant pas pour but de maitriser et comprendre son µC). C'est pourquoi j'ai du mal à comprendre ta position...
    Bonsoir.
    Ça me rappelle l'ambiance du club d'informatique ou j'allais régulièrement à la fin des années 80: il y avait ceux qui étaient sur .Mac, ceux qui étaient sur Pc, ceux qui étaient sur Atari St, ceux qui étaient sur Amiga et ceux qui étaient sur Commodire 64. Naturellement, tous étaient persuadés que les machines des autres étaient irrémédiablement inférieures. Entre groupes, on ne se parlait pas. Sauf pour se dire ça, bien entendu.

  12. #9
    balisto56

    Re : CP2102 + Arduino Pro Mini 5V/16Mhz ATmega328 == avrdude: stk500_getsync(): not in sync: resp=0x

    Citation Envoyé par Yvan_Delaserge Voir le message
    Ça me rappelle l'ambiance du club d'informatique ou j'allais régulièrement à la fin des années 80: il y avait ceux qui étaient sur .Mac, ceux qui étaient sur Pc, ceux qui étaient sur Atari St, ceux qui étaient sur Amiga et ceux qui étaient sur Commodire 64. Naturellement, tous étaient persuadés que les machines des autres étaient irrémédiablement inférieures. Entre groupes, on ne se parlait pas. Sauf pour se dire ça, bien entendu.
    Bonjour.

    A la seule différence, c'est que je n'ai jamais lu ici un Arduiniste critiquer un Picaxiste avec autant de vigueur comme le font les Picaxistes envers les Arduinistes.
    Parfois avec une telle haine que cela me fais penser au supporter du MSG et de l'OM.
    Je vais peut-être en faire un sujet d'étude pour mes élèves.
    Cordialement.

    PS: Suggestion aux modérateurs de ce forum. Pourquoi ne pas ouvrir une section spéciale arduino ?
    Dans nombreux cas, il est important de séparer les belligérants.

Sur le même thème :

Discussions similaires

  1. [Numérique] Pin AREF arduino atmega328
    Par ktber dans le forum Électronique
    Réponses: 3
    Dernier message: 23/05/2016, 06h23
  2. Erreur Arduino UNO : avrdude: stk500_getsync(): not in sync
    Par flaps dans le forum Électronique
    Réponses: 34
    Dernier message: 17/05/2015, 20h02
  3. Réponses: 41
    Dernier message: 24/06/2014, 12h38
  4. ports pb6/pb7 sur arduino/atmega328
    Par Hoedus dans le forum Électronique
    Réponses: 2
    Dernier message: 13/05/2011, 15h01
Découvrez nos comparatifs produits sur l'informatique et les technologies.